jQuery中的data()方法
data()方法,用于存储/获取临时数据
HTML data-* 属性
在标签中利用 data-* 设置自定义的属性,存储数据。
<div id="person"> <p data-fullname="张小明" data-age="24" data-profession="前端开发工程师">小明</p>
<p data-fullname="刘小红" data-age="24" data-profession="UI设计师">小红</p> </div>
<button type="button" id="btn1">获取data</button>
<button type="button" id="btn2">修改data</button>
jQuery data()
用data()方法获取和修改临时数据。
$("#btn1").click(function(){ alert($("#person p").data("fullname"));//获取匹配的元素集合中的第一个元素的data的值。 });
$("#btn2").click(function(){
$("#person p:eq(0)").data({
"fullname": "王小虎",
"age": "29",
"profession" ".Net开发工程师"
});
});